What Is a French Crop Haircut?

A French crop is a short men’s haircut with a neat, trimmed back and sides and a small fringe brushed forward. The top is usually textured, giving the hair a soft and natural look.

It’s known for being easy to style, low-maintenance, and flattering for many face shapes. The French crop is popular because it looks clean, modern, and works well for everyday life.

History of the French Crop Haircut

The French crop has been around for many years and has roots in classic European men’s grooming. Soldiers and working men liked it because it was simple, clean, and easy to keep neat. Over time, this haircut became a modern favorite, especially as barbers added new touches like fades, texture, and different fringe shapes. Today, it’s seen as a timeless style that mixes old-school simplicity with fresh, trendy details.

How to Style a French Crop

Styling a French crop is quick and easy. Start with clean, slightly damp hair. Add a small amount of light styling product, like clay or matte cream. Brush or push the top forward to shape the fringe, then use your fingers to add soft texture.

The sides stay clean on their own, so you don’t need much effort. For a sharper look, you can ask your barber to tidy the fade every few weeks.

Do French crop hairstyles have a side part?

Most French crops don’t use a side part because the hair is usually brushed forward with a small fringe. However, some modern versions do include a soft side push or a light side-swept top for extra style. So while a classic French crop is not parted, you can choose a version that leans slightly to one side if you want a more relaxed look.
